首页 > 代码库 > 华为机试—物品放箩筐(只有体积)
华为机试—物品放箩筐(只有体积)
#include <iostream> #include <string> using namespace std; int main() { int arr[30],i,j; for (i=0;i<30;i++) { cin>>arr[i]; } for (i=0;i<30;i++) { for (j=0;j<=i;j++) { int tmp; if (arr[i]<=arr[j]) { tmp=arr[j]; arr[j]=arr[i]; arr[i]=tmp; } } } for (i=0;i<30;i++) cout<<arr[i]<<" "; cout<<endl; int sum=0; for (i=0;i<30;i++) { sum=sum+arr[i]; if (sum>100) { cout<<i<<endl; break; } } if (sum<=100) { cout<<30; } return 0; }
华为机试—物品放箩筐(只有体积)
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。